Hunter’s Chicken Recipe

Inspired by The Iowa Taproom
Time50m
Serves4

Sautéed airline chicken breast covered in mushrooms, onions, tomato, shallot and tarragon. Finished with a porter demi-glace. Served with yukon gold smashed potatoes and steamed broccoli.

Method

To Prepare the Hunter's Chicken

  1. 1

    Sauté the Chicken

    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Season the airline chicken breasts with salt and black pepper. Sauté the chicken for about 5-6 minutes per side until golden brown and fully cooked. Remove from the skillet and set aside.

  2. 2

    Cook the Vegetables

    In the same skillet, add the diced onion, minced shallot, and sliced mushrooms. Cook for 3-4 minutes until the vegetables are softened. Add the diced tomato and chopped tarragon, and stir to combine.

  3. 3

    Prepare the Sauce

    Pour in the porter beer and let it simmer for 2-3 minutes to reduce slightly. Stir in the beef demi-glace and simmer for another 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ens. Return the chicken breasts to the pan, coating them in the sauce. Cook for an additional 2 minutes to heat through.

To Make the Yukon Gold Smashed Potatoes

  1. 4

    Boil the Potatoes

    Peel and chop the Yukon Gold potatoes into uniform chunks. Place them in a pot of salted water and bring to a boil. Cook for about 15-20 minutes, or until fork-tender.

  2. 5

    Mash the Potatoes

    Drain the potatoes and return them to the pot. Add butter and heavy cream, mashing until smooth but still slightly chunky.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.

To Steam the Broccoli

  1. 6

    Prepare the Broccoli

    In a steamer basket over boiling water, add the broccoli florets. Cover and steam for 5-7 minutes until bright green and tender-crisp.

  2. 7

    Finishing Touch

    Drizzle the steamed broccoli with olive oil and sprinkle with salt before serving.
